DISH Network to acquire Blockbuster’s assets
Englewood, CO, United States (AHN) – DISH Network Corp. has been selected as the winning bidder in the bankruptcy court auction for all of Blockbuster, Inc.’s assets. DISH Network’s winning bid was valued at nearly $320 million.
In announcing the acquisition, DISH Network said Wednesday it will pay out approximately $228 million in cash to acquire Blockbuster sometime in the second quarter of 2011.
“With its more than 1,700 store locations, a highly recognizable brand and multiple methods of delivery, Blockbuster will complement our existing video offerings while presenting cross-marketing and service extension opportunities for DISH Network,” said Tom Cullen, executive vice president of sales, marketing and programming for DISH Network.
He went on to say, “While Blockbuster’s business faces significant challenges, we look forward to working with its employees to re-establish Blockbuster’s brand as a leader in video entertainment.”
Completion of the deal is contingent upon certain conditions being met and bankruptcy court approval.
